5개의 이더넷 인터페이스가 있습니다(장치 2개, 온보드 1개, 이더넷 카드 4개).
그들은 이름이...
eONBOARD
eA eB eC eD
추가 카드의 각 인터페이스에서 macvtap을 사용하고 있습니다. 그러면 libvirt 게스트가 이를 사용하게 됩니다.
게스트가 아닌 모든 트래픽이 eONBOARD만 사용하도록 하고 싶습니다. 내 호스트가 다른 인터페이스를 직접 사용하는 것을 원하지 않습니다.
IP 경로 표시
default via 10.0.20.10 dev eD src 10.0.20.9 metric 202
default via 10.0.10.10 dev eONBOARD src 10.0.10.1 metric 203
default via 10.0.20.10 dev eC src 10.0.20.8 metric 204
default via 10.0.20.10 dev eB src 10.0.20.7 metric 205
default via 10.0.10.10 dev eA src 10.0.20.6 metric 206
10.0.10.0/24 dev eONBOARD proto kernel scope link src 10.0.10.200 metric 203
10.0.10.0/24 dev eA proto kernel scope link src 10.0.10.6 metric 206
10.0.20.0/24 dev eD proto kernel scope link src 10.0.20.9 metric 202
10.0.20.0/24 dev eC proto kernel scope link src 10.0.20.8 metric 204
10.0.20.0/24 dev eB proto kernel scope link src 10.0.20.7 metric 205
보시다시피 eD가 선호되는 경로입니다(이로 인해 호스트가 이 인터페이스에서 게스트와 대화하는 데 문제가 발생함).
누구든지 Arch Linux에서 작동하도록 하는 방법을 제안할 수 있습니까?
감사해요